package com.android.server.connectivity;
import android.annotation.NonNull;
import android.annotation.Nullable;
import android.net.NetworkRequest;
import java.util.Collection;
/**
* A class that knows how to find the best network matching a request out of a list of networks.
*/
public class NetworkRanker {
public NetworkRanker() { }
/**
* Find the best network satisfying this request among the list of passed networks.
*/
// Almost equivalent to Collections.max(nais), but allows returning null if no network
// satisfies the request.
@Nullable
public NetworkAgentInfo getBestNetwork(@NonNull final NetworkRequest request,
@NonNull final Collection<NetworkAgentInfo> nais) {
NetworkAgentInfo bestNetwork = null;
int bestScore = Integer.MIN_VALUE;
for (final NetworkAgentInfo nai : nais) {
if (!nai.satisfies(request)) continue;
if (nai.getCurrentScore() > bestScore) {
bestNetwork = nai;
bestScore = nai.getCurrentScore();
}
}
return bestNetwork;
}
}
